This new product is launched based on Lantek Expert (CAD/CAM) and Lantek MES. Together, Lantek MES+ and Lantek Analytics integrate the value proposition for advanced manufacturing, Synergy Intelligence.
In order for Lantek MES+ to work offering the best performance of the company, it is necessary to feed it the company’s data. But not just any data, it has to be adequate to the questions asked, those that offer a historical perspective of the plant, that describe its evolution to identify behavioral patterns in our clients, their orders, etc. We can do two things with this, and this is where Lantek Analytics comes in. On the one hand, a descriptive analysis based on the data of what has happened in the past, which help to make decisions in the future; and on the other, a predictive analysis that allows you to anticipate the future and optimize your resources.
The combination of these scenarios will help factory managers to make better decisions and get the best performance out of the plant, with maximal efficiency and productivity levels while also substantially reducing costs.
Let’s look at the features of Lantek MES+ in detail:
General overview
This software has the ability to offer a complete overview of the plant’s manufacturing and of each and every one of the production processes, and all this in real time. Precise information on the state of the machines (availability, maintenance, load state), and of the warehouse’s capacity to satisfy the material needs for the orders. In addition, it offers the ability to view the progress of the orders and to know what manufacturing stage they are at (cutting, bending, painting, assembling, etc.), and the delivery deadlines. All of this data when viewed together offers answers, solutions for any eventuality.
Intelligent planning
This tool makes it possible to provide an automatic planning response, taking into account all of the orders available. A management tool that receives feedback from real-world incidents (unscheduled stops, urgent orders, lack of workers...), and also input thanks to the data generated by Lantek Analytics. This adaptation goes as far as being capable of generating a virtual simulation of any possible contingency.
